Some airports across the country now have dedicated “family lanes” to make travel easier and less stressful. The Transportation Security Administration has launched dedicated lanes at airports in Orlando, Orange County, Honolulu, Charlotte, and several others as part of its “Families on the Fly” initiative. The lanes are meant for families with children ages 12 and under. Families also have access to discounted TSA PreCheck fees and dedicated TSA PreCheck lanes for military service members and their families. "We understand that air travel can be challenging, especially for parents managing strollers, diaper bags, and young kids,” TSA Federal Security Director for Orlando Pete Garcia said. “It’s about addressing the unique needs of traveling families.”
